The Dorman 924-375 Rear Brake Backing Plate is a high-quality replacement designed specifically for select Subaru models. Made from durable, corrosion-resistant steel, it ensures a longer service life while providing a perfect fit and function. This precision-engineered part has been rigorously tested for quality, making it an ideal solution for replacing deteriorating original components.

I wasted an afternoon trying to get these to work
To be fair to Amazon, I purchased a set of these from RockAuto.com, not Amazon. To be fair to anyone else thinking about buying them, I had a HELL of a time getting them to fit. The four boles holes that are pre-drilled in these back plates DO NOT line up with the holes they need to on the knuckle; a couple of them were off by almost an 1/8th of an inch. In order for me to get them to fit I had to drill with the biggest drill bit that I had, ream with a tapered 3/4" reamer for awhile then file with a round file until I finally did it. I wasted an afternoon trying to get these to work. I suppose a larger, more aggressive round file would've made things go easier but I was stranded with a non-driveable vehicle and didn't have access to one. Although the only alternative to these was twice as expensive, if I was anxious to get the job done I would buy a different brand next time.
